Welcome to
ESL Printables, the website where English Language teachers exchange resources: worksheets, lesson plans,  activities, etc.
Our collection is growing every day with the help of many teachers. If you want to download you have to send your own contributions.

 

 

English worksheets  > contributions by Saff

 

The author



Saff
Safiro Rivera Mena
Costa Rica



Points: 1565

 


order results: newest first - most downloaded first - alphabetically random order

 

Printables

 

PowerPoints

Online exercises


 
At the Zoo
Filling in the blanks ;)
Level: elementary
Age: 8-12
Type: worksheet
Downloads: 16


 
School Life
Activities to help students become familiar with American high schools!
Level: intermediate
Age: 13-100
Type: worksheet
Downloads: 103


 
Eating Well
Worksheet containing different activities to review aspects related to healthy eating habits.
Level: intermediate
Age: 13-17
Type: worksheet
Downloads: 97


 
You found me
Song to review simple past tense :)
Level: intermediate
Age: 13-100
Type: worksheet
Downloads: 54


 
A-MAZE-ME
Useful worksheet to teach vocabulary regarding Natural Resources
Level: intermediate
Age: 13-100
Type: worksheet
Downloads: 13


 
Parts of a Laptop
Vocabulary related to laptops.
Level: intermediate
Age: 13-100
Type: worksheet
Downloads: 98


 
4Rs
Worksheet with some vocabulary related to the 4Rs. Some examples are given =)
Level: intermediate
Age: 12-100
Type: worksheet
Downloads: 40


 
At the Supermarket
Speaking, listening, and writing activities to enhance cultural knowledge regarding supermarkets.
Level: intermediate
Age: 12-100
Type: worksheet
Downloads: 82


 
Telling the time
Helpful worksheet to help students remember how to tell the time.
Level: elementary
Age: 10-100
Type: worksheet
Downloads: 90


 
Eat it!
Song to review vocabulary related to food!
Level: intermediate
Age: 13-100
Type: worksheet
Downloads: 100

 


Phrasal Verbs
Useful PPT to introduce phrasal verbs :)

Level: intermediate
Age: 13-100
Downloads: 50


Second Conditional
PPT to teach conditionals!

Level: intermediate
Age: 13-100
Downloads: 39

Found 0 online exercises